Which generation this is

The supplier part description for 39473010 reads TSP143 IVUE, and it is easy to read that as a variant of the TSP143III. It is not. The IV is the generation: this is a TSP100IV, Star's 2022 platform, and it is a different printer from the TSP100III in body, ports and software support. It is roughly 20 percent smaller than the III, it uses USB-C rather than USB Type-B, and it is the only one of the three TSP143 models we stock that appears on Star's CloudPRNT Next compatibility list. If you are matching an existing estate of TSP100III printers, this is not a like-for-like spare; if you are buying new, it is the current model.

Ethernet and USB-C

This part number is the dual interface build. An RJ45 Ethernet port puts the printer on the store network so any till, tablet or back-office system can reach it by address, and a USB-C port takes a direct connection from a PC or Mac when a network is not wanted. A third port, USB Type-A, is there for the device rather than the host: it supports Android Open Accessory so an Android tablet can drive the printer over the same lead that charges it, at up to 1.5 amps. What this part number does not have is Bluetooth or Wi-Fi. Those live on separate Star part numbers, and at least one distributor catalogue lists wireless against this code in error.

Cloud and integration

Star lists the TSP143IV on its CloudPRNT Next compatible model table, which matters if you want a hosted ordering platform to push a receipt or a kitchen ticket to the printer without a local application in the middle. PromoPRNT can add a promotional footer to a printed receipt. On the development side Star publishes the StarXpand SDK for iOS, Android and React Native, the older StarPRNT SDK, a CloudPRNT SDK and the WebPRNT browser interface, alongside conventional Windows drivers, OPOS, JavaPOS and CUPS for Mac and Linux. Neither TSP100III model in this range supports CloudPRNT Next.

Speed and cutter life

Every TSP143 in this range prints at the same headline rate, up to 250 millimetres per second at 203 dpi, which clears a normal grocery or hospitality receipt in about a second. What separates a printer that lasts from one that does not is the cutter, and Star rates the guillotine here at two million cuts. The print head is rated for 100 kilometres of paper and the mechanism carries a 60 million line MCBF figure. For a till running two hundred transactions a day those numbers are the difference between a consumable and a fixture. Media handling is drop-in: lift the cover, drop the roll in, close it, and the printer feeds and cuts without threading.

Internal power supply

The power supply is inside the printer. That sounds like a footnote until you have wired a counter and discovered that the printer needs somewhere to hide a brick, and that the brick has to sit where a cleaner will not kick it. Star runs mains straight into the chassis at 100 to 240 volts, 50 or 60 hertz, so the only thing leaving the printer is a detachable mains cord. It makes the unit slightly deeper than a printer with an external adapter and considerably tidier once installed. It also means one fewer part to lose when a unit is moved between sites, and one fewer thing to specify when you order a replacement.

What is included

Star's datasheet for this part number lists the printer, a mains power cable, a USB-C to USB Type-A data cable, an Ethernet cable and the 58 millimetre paper guide. Shipping both interface cables is unusual and worth knowing, because it means the printer works out of the box whichever of the two connection methods you choose on the day. Some distributor listings additionally claim a mounting kit and a starter paper roll against this code; Star's own included-items list does not itemise either, so we do not claim them. If you need a wall or under-counter mount, specify it separately rather than assuming one is in the carton.

Warranty and support

Star covers this printer in the United States with a 2-year warranty, and offers EXTEND-A-STAR and SWAP-A-STAR service plans that take the term to three or four years, with SWAP-A-STAR providing an advance replacement unit rather than a repair turnaround. Note that Star's European operation publishes a longer standard term; the figure that applies to a printer bought in the United States is the 2-year one, and that is what we quote. Drivers, manuals and configuration utilities remain available from Star's support site, and the unit is Energy Star certified.
